Spencer Island

Island in Nunavut, Canada From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Remove ads

Spencer Island is one of several uninhabited Canadian arctic islands in Nunavut, Canada located within James Bay. It is situated 19 km (19,000 m) northwest from North Twin Island.[1] During surveys in James Bay[when?], polar bears were sighted using the island for summer refuge.[2]
